explain why a crumpled up ball of paper fallls differently than a flat sheet of paper though they weigh the same.

because the have different surface areas and each of their surface areas resist air differently. Air is not weightless and has an average weight of .0807lbs.
Therefore two papers falling with different surface areas will respond differently to the same amount of resistance.
An example is to compare an man falling with an open parachute, and the same man falling with a closed parachute. The open parachute "catches" air because air has a weight and volume.
